Mel Brooks’ The Producers isn’t just a musical, it’s a Broadway revolution wrapped in a scandalous, tap-dancing farce. What began as a 1967 cult film exploded into a record-breaking Tony-winning masterpiece, full of audacity and absurdity. Watching Max Bialystock and Leo Bloom scheme their way to success (through a musical about Hitler, no less) somehow becomes comedy gold. The Producers bursts off the stage with choreography as over-the-top as its characters. One moment you’re in a sleazy office, the next you’re front row at “Springtime for Hitler” complete with chorus girls in swastika-styled costumes. But it’s the chemistry between the leads that drives it: neurotic Leo, larger-than-life Max, and the unforgettable Ulla. Every number lands with the precision of a perfectly rehearsed punchline.
